Output e8e3880ceec908c65defcf9560f8e426f3a7180b1e5de0aa220a868fe8def3b3:2

value
19015055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d999100978ab04dec912815b0bd3fed420d1d1bb OP_EQUAL
address
3MXZv9eejhA8s5LsiCHjvLhQe2swNTtokr
transaction
e8e3880ceec908c65defcf9560f8e426f3a7180b1e5de0aa220a868fe8def3b3
spent
true